The Ultimate Buying Guide for Dog Kennels
Choosing the right dog kennel is important. A good kennel gives your dog a safe, comfortable space. It can be used for training, travel, or just giving your dog a quiet spot at home. We will help you pick the best one.
Key Features to Look For
Several features make a kennel great. Think about what your dog needs most.
Size Matters Most
- Proper Fit: Your dog must be able to stand up, turn around easily, and lie down comfortably. Too small is cruel; too big might encourage accidents.
- Growth Room: If you have a puppy, buy a kennel that fits their adult size. Use dividers now, and remove them as they grow.
Security and Access
- Secure Latches: Latches must be strong. A determined dog can push open weak doors. Look for double-bolt locking systems.
- Door Placement: Some kennels have one door, others have two. Multiple doors offer flexibility when placing the kennel in a room.
Ventilation and Visibility
- Airflow: Good airflow keeps your dog cool and happy. Look for wire sides or plenty of mesh panels.
- Cleaning Access: Removable trays underneath make cleanup much easier. This is a huge time saver for owners.
Important Materials in Dog Kennels
The material affects durability, weight, and cost. Different materials fit different needs.
Plastic Kennels (Travel and Indoor Use)
These are usually lightweight and easy to clean. High-density polyethylene (HDPE) plastic lasts a long time. Quality plastic resists cracking better than cheap alternatives.
Wire Crates (Training and Home Base)
Wire crates offer the best ventilation and visibility. They are easily collapsible for storage. Look for heavy-gauge steel wire. Thicker wire means less bending or chewing damage.
Heavy-Duty or Impact Kennels (Strong Chewers)
These are often made of thick metal or composite materials. They are perfect for powerful dogs or for use in vehicles where extra protection is needed.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all kennels are made equally. Pay attention to construction details.
Quality Indicators (What to look for)
- Smooth Welds: On wire crates, check that all welds are smooth. Sharp edges can injure your dog.
- Rust Resistance: Metal kennels must have a good powder coating or be made of stainless steel. Rust weakens the structure quickly.
- Sturdy Hardware: Screws and bolts should feel solid, not flimsy.
Quality Reducers (What to avoid)
- Thin Metal: Very thin metal panels dent easily.
- Flimsy Plastic Hinges: These break after only a few uses.
- No Non-Slip Feet: Kennels that slide around on the floor are unstable and frustrating for the dog.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about *why* you need the kennel. This guides your final decision.
Training and Housebreaking
Wire crates are often preferred here. They allow the dog to see their surroundings, which reduces anxiety. The crate simulates a den.
Travel and Transport
Plastic travel crates are usually the safest choice for car or air travel because they offer full protection from all sides. Make sure the crate meets airline standards if you plan to fly.
Outdoor Use
If the kennel stays outside, it needs a waterproof roof and must resist weather damage. Heavy-duty metal kennels with secure roofs work best outdoors.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Dog Kennels
Q: How do I choose the right size kennel?
A: Measure your dog from nose to the base of the tail. Add 4-6 inches to that length. Measure them standing up. The height should allow them to stand without hitting their head.
Q: Is it okay for my dog to sleep in a crate all night?
A: Yes, if the crate is the right size and they are crate-trained properly. It should be a safe place, not punishment.
Q: What is the difference between a crate and a kennel?
A: Often, the terms are used interchangeably. “Crate” usually refers to smaller, portable wire or plastic enclosures for home use or travel. “Kennel” can refer to larger, more permanent outdoor structures.
Q: Should I put bedding inside the crate?
A: Yes, use a comfortable, washable bed or blanket. However, if your puppy chews bedding, remove it until they stop chewing.
Q: Are metal crates safe for puppies?
A: They are safe, but puppies can sometimes get their paws or heads stuck in very large wire spacing. Choose crates with smaller spacing for young dogs.
Q: How do I stop my dog from barking in the travel kennel?
A: Acclimate your dog slowly. Cover the kennel with a blanket to make it feel more den-like and secure during travel.
Q: What is the best material for outdoor kennels?
A: Galvanized steel or heavy-duty aluminum offers the best protection against rain and sun damage.
Q: Are plastic crates safe if my dog chews everything?
A: Plastic can be chewed, but heavy-duty, thick plastic is harder to break than thin plastic. Watch chewers closely in any enclosure.
Q: How often should I clean the dog kennel?
A: Clean up accidents immediately. Do a full deep clean, including washing the bedding, at least once a week.
Q: Can I use a divider panel in a large crate?
A: Absolutely. Dividers are necessary when house-training puppies. They make a large crate feel cozy and prevent the puppy from using one end as a bathroom.
